Recognizing Microneedling
Microneedling, while it may sound intimidating, is a minimally invasive procedure that advertises skin restoration. Throughout the treatment, a gadget equipped with great needles produces little punctures in your skin, boosting your body's natural recovery reaction. This process boosts collagen and elastin production, which are necessary for preserving youthful and durable skin.
You might be wondering what to expect during the treatment. First, your specialist uses a topical numbing cream to reduce discomfort. Once your skin is prepared, they'll use the microneedling tool to gently slide over the treatment location. You might feel minor stress or a prickling sensation, but it shouldn't be painful.
Later, your skin might appear red and somewhat inflamed, similar to a moderate sunburn. This reaction is typical and typically subsides within a couple of days. As your skin heals, you'll discover renovations in appearance, tone, and even the appearance of scars.
Usually, several sessions are suggested to achieve optimal outcomes. Incorporating microneedling right into your skin care routine can be an efficient means to boost your skin tone while addressing various skin problems.
Exploring Chemical Peels
Chemical peels offer one more effective alternative for skin rejuvenation, targeting a range of problems from great lines to acne scars. https://www.bodyandsoul.com.au/relationships/dating-advice/expert-advice-my-friend-lied-to-me-about-having-plastic-surgery-but-why/news-story/03be2d07cebd3747473fc3d1ecc4083e includes applying a chemical solution to your skin, which exfoliates the external layers and promotes new skin development.
Relying on your skin type and objectives, you can select from shallow, tool, or deep peels. Shallow peels are mild and largely address minor staining and dry skin. Tool peels permeate deeper, tackling much more pronounced wrinkles and sunlight damages, while deep peels are matched for substantial skin problems yet call for more downtime.
Prior to undergoing a chemical peel, you should seek advice from an expert. They'll assess your skin and advise the best type for your needs. It's additionally necessary to prepare your skin by avoiding certain products and sun direct exposure in the weeks leading up to your treatment.
Post-peel, you'll require to follow aftercare instructions carefully to make certain optimum results. This may include using gentle cleansers, applying moisturizers, and avoiding sunlight direct exposure.
With proper care, you can delight in smoother, a lot more glowing skin, boosting your overall skin tone and enhancing your self-confidence.
